David Willetts is Minister of State for Universities and Science. He has been the Member of Parliament for Havant since 1992. He was Shadow Secretary of State for Work and Pensions from 2001-2005 and has worked at the Centre for Policy Studies, HM Treasury, and the Number 10 Policy Unit.

In this roundtable lunch, David outlined the challenges facing the Coalition government in the sphere of Higher Education, including the implications of the new method of funding university education for the public finances.
